Stress Analyst salary in Spain

Average Yearly Salary of Stress Analyst in Spain is approximately 52,732 EUR (52,995 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. What does Stress Analyst do?

occupation personasA stress analyst is a professional responsible for analyzing and evaluating the structural integrity and performance of various components and systems. They use mathematical models, computer simulations, and engineering principles to assess the impact of external forces such as pressure, temperature, and vibrations on materials and structures. Stress analysts work across industries such as aerospace, automotive, manufacturing, and civil engineering to ensure that designs meet safety and performance requirements.
